Only travellers from banned ‘red zone’ countries will be forced to quarantine.

The government has announced that travellers arriving in the UK from ‘red zone’ countries will be required to self-isolate in provided accommodation.

The ‘red zone’ list is made up of countries currently subject to the UK’s travel ban, which the government says people travelling from “will not be granted access to the UK”.

The countries currently on the list, and soon to be subject to compulsory hotel quarantines, are:

  1. Angola
  2. Argentina
  3. Bolivia
  4. Botswana
  5. Brazil
  6. Burundi
  7. Cape Verde
  8. Chile
  9. Colombia
  10. Democratic Republic of Congo
  11. Ecuador
  12. Eswatini
  13. French Guiana
  14. Guyana
  15. Lesotho
  16. Malawi
  17. Mauritius
  18. Mozambique
  19. Namibia
  20. Panama
  21. Paraguay
  22. Peru
  23. Portugal (including Madeira and the Azores)
  24. Rwanda
  25. Seychelles
  26. South Africa
  27. Suriname
  28. Tanzania
  29. United Arab Emirates (UAE)
  30. Uruguay
  31. Venezuela
  32. Zambia
  33. Zimbabwe
